Summary, in English

C57BL/6N mice were i.v. injected with 0, 30, 60, 90, 120, or 150 MBq 177Lu-octreotate (0, 16, 29, 40, 48, and 54 Gy to the kidneys). At 4, 8, and 12 months after administration, radiation-induced effects were evaluated in relation to (a) global transcriptional variations in kidney tissues, (b) morphological changes in the kidneys, (c) changes in white and red blood cell count as well as blood levels of urea, and (d) changes in renal function using 99mTc-DTPA/99mTc-DMSA scintigraphy.
